From the Pen of the Principals

Primary School Dear Endeavour Schools’ families, Welcome back to Term 3! I hope you all had a wonderful break and are ready for a fantastic term! We finished the end of last term with our Principal’s Afternoon Tea. This was an opportunity for us to celebrate with students from every class who have completed outstanding work throughout Term 2. Each student who attended shared their work with the whole group. I was very impressed with the level of work and the students’ ability to articulate the purpose behind their work and their learning. Congratulations to all those students! See the photo below of all our worthy recipients. As we move to the second half of 2020 we are working hard on gathering data to inform the development of our next Business Plan. During the School Development days this week staff worked with the leadership team to complete a self-review of our performance over the duration of our current Business Plan (2018—2020). We also provided some Professional Learning to lay the foundations for some of our strategies we are planning to implement over the next three years in the Fogarty EDvance School Improvement program. We had an intense two days and I would like to acknowledge the dedication of our staff – they all work very hard to ensure Endeavour Schools is providing the best for our students. It has been brought to my attention that there are some concerns about our student’s awareness of road safety. I have asked that teachers address this through their teaching programs. I am also currently investigating some possible incursions we can access to help us keep this a high priority. We are going to trial having a whole school assembly in the undercover area next Friday, 31st July. This assembly will be run the same as the WebEx assemblies in that we will not be having a class item. Parents of students receiving certificates will be invited to attend if they wish. We need to ensure that parents attending follow the social distancing protocols so please help us with this. I am really looking forward to the Interschool Cross Country next week and wish all our competitors all the best. Thanks go to Mr Nurse for all his work in preparing our students for this event. If you have any queries or are interested in finding out more about what is happening in the school please don’t hesitate to contact me. Jennette Maxfield - Principal

Education Support Centre Dear parents and caregivers, Welcome back to Term 3, we hope you all had a restful break! This Term we welcome back Mrs Berrin Baydar from her maternity leave. Mrs Baydar will be working across our classes and Room 9 on Fridays. Make sure you take a minute to say hello. We finished last term with our Good Standing reward day Pizza, Picnic & Play. For all those students who maintained their Good Standing status throughout the term. Its was a glorious winters day and there were picnic blankets galore and pizza for everyone. This could not have happed for our students without the dedication of a group of parent volunteers who gave their time to pack the pizzas for the students. Elizabeth Overell and her band of wonderful helpers - we can’t thank you enough for your help in feeding all of our 510 students. Watch this space for what is planned for our Term 3 event. Reports were sent home in the last week of school via email. If you did not receive an email or would like a hard copy, please see the ladies in the front office. Please feel free to provide the office feedback on receiving reports this way either by phoning the school office on 9524 5000 or email [email protected]. During day 1 and 2 of Term 3 teachers spent working on school improvement across our Fogarty School Improvement plan. The main focus areas were: 1. Student Progress 2. Student Engagement 3. Staff Leadership We will continue working throughout our plan for the next 3 years in achieving our goals. We will be continually seeking parent, student and community feedback along the way and updates will be given through our newsletter, school Board

and P & C. Have a great term, take care. Jayne Gorbould - ESC Principal

FREE PARENTING SEMINARS

You are invited to attend the Triple P Seminar Series. You will learn practical, positive and effective ways to deal with common behavioural problems and ways to help your child achieve their best at school and in the future. Parents are encouraged to attend all 3 seminars: 1. Children's behaviour - the tough part of parenting 2. Raising Confident Children 3. Raising Emotionally Resilient Children The next FREE 3 week Series is starting 28th July 2020 at the Westerly Family Centre, Cooloongup. Bookings are essential and places are limited.

Limited Crèche will be available but please book direct at the venue - 9592 3650. Please visit our website
